1) Overview<br />
TMAP application<br />
An independent application called TMAP is provided for MAP-based<br />
monitoring.<br />
TMAP is installed on <strong>Cymanager</strong> installation, and can be launched from<br />
<strong>Cymanager</strong>.<br />
TMAP gets the information on servers/cameras from the <strong>Cymanager</strong>. So<br />
<strong>Cymanager</strong> should be running for TMAP’s operation.<br />
Since TMAP and <strong>Cymanager</strong> communicate using TCP/IP, they can run on<br />
different PCs. Furthermore it is possible to make one TMAP application work<br />
with more than one <strong>Cymanager</strong>. For example, there can be four PCs each of<br />
which is running <strong>Cymanager</strong> for 16 channel monitoring, and one additional PC<br />
dedicated for TMAP application.<br />
TMAP provides the following functions.<br />
- Display image maps with camera icons on it<br />
- Display pop-up video manually or by events<br />
- Event handling: various actions on events including pop-up video display,<br />
highlighting the camera icon, and sound effect<br />
- On-screen PTZ control<br />
- Camera selection: camera selection on TMAP is reflected to <strong>Cymanager</strong><br />
